Signed, Sealed, Delivered: From Paris with Love is a romantic comedy-drama film released in 2015. The movie follows the story of four lovable postal workers - Oliver O’Toole (Eric Mabius), Shane McInerney (Kristin Booth), Rita Haywith (Crystal Lowe), and Norman Dorman (Geoff Gustafson) as they embark on a new international adventure.

In the opening scenes of the movie, Oliver receives a mysterious letter containing a letter opener from an anonymous sender. This intrigues him and he decides to investigate further. The team soon discovers that the letter and the decorative letter opener are from an old military pen pal of an American soldier who fought in the Second World War. The pen pal is now a 90-year-old Frenchwoman named Mathilde (Marion Ross). Mathilde used to correspond with the soldier and she now wants to reunite with him after all the years that have gone by.

As Oliver and his team work on discovering the identity of the soldier, they find themselves heading to France on a mission to find him. Things get complicated when they discover that the soldier had a son, who is also missing, and there is a bitter family feud going on between him and his sister. The team quickly becomes involved in the conflict and does their best to find the missing son all while trying to reunite Mathilde with her long lost love.

As the story progresses, Oliver becomes increasingly obsessed with finding the soldier’s son and reuniting Mathilde with her love. Shane, who has developed a romantic interest in Oliver over the course of the series, becomes increasingly worried about how much he is sacrificing for the mission. She confides in Rita, who has troubles of her own, and the two of them start to wonder if they should tell Oliver how they feel.

Aside from the main plotline, the movie also has several subplots that are weaved seamlessly into the overarching story. These subplots include Norman’s ongoing search for love, Shane dealing with the aftermath of her mother’s death, and Rita trying to reconnect with an old friend.

The film itself is beautifully shot and captures the essence of Paris. The Eiffel Tower, the Seine River, and Notre Dame all feature prominently in the story. The stunning backdrop of the French capital city adds to the romance, drama, and mystery of the film.

The cast of Signed, Sealed, Delivered: From Paris with Love is excellent. Eric Mabius, who plays Oliver, is perfectly cast as the team leader, obsessed with solving the mystery of the missing soldier’s son. Kristin Booth, who plays Shane, is the perfect foil for Mabius' character. She is strong, smart, and capable, yet she is also vulnerable and empathetic. The chemistry between Mabius and Booth is palpable and drives much of the film’s tension.

Crystal Lowe, as Rita, is excellent as well. She brings depth and nuance to her character, and the subplot involving her friendship with a troubled woman is both poignant and moving. Geoff Gustafson, who plays Norman, is also excellent. His character’s search for love is both charming and funny, and he provides a great source of levity in the film.

The film’s pacing is excellent, and it manages to balance the romance, drama, and mystery elements of the story beautifully. Director Kevin Fair is a master at creating compelling narratives, and he does an excellent job with this film.
